Abbey Blackwell Shares River or a Road
When listening to Abbey Blackwell‘s solo efforts, you’re going to get transported; her work in a sense, is reminiscent of old folk singers, like this magical crossroads between Joni Mitchell or Joan Baez on guitar with the heavy dulcet tones of Nico. It’s an enchanting place to play, with Blackwell carefully detailing our impact on loved ones, and what we leave behind in moments of separation, all of it carefully balled up beneath this ornate strum. The video below has some wonderful digitalization, bringing the sentiment in Abbey’s work to a colorful screen near you. Her album Big Big Motion is out on September 13th for those looking to disappear into an artist’s musical statement.
